Ali Khamenei Appears at Religious Ceremony, First Public Appearance After Iran-Israel Conflict
AFP, Tehran - Iranian state media reported that Iranian Supreme Leader Ali Khamenei appeared publicly today, marking the first time he has been seen in public since the 12-day war between Iran and Israel.
In footage broadcast by Iranian state television, Khamenei was seen at a mosque, greeting worshippers and receiving cheers from the crowd.
Khamenei had previously delivered a recorded speech last week, but he has not appeared publicly since Israel suddenly launched an air strike on Iran on June 13, triggering the conflict.
In the footage, 86-year-old Khamenei was seen wearing black on stage, with the crowd below waving fists and chanting: "Our blood in our veins is dedicated to our leader!"
